Register Your Business Name


The first step in safeguarding your business name is to officially register it with the appropriate government authorities. This helps establish your legal ownership and prevents others in your jurisdiction from using a similar name.

Trademark Your Name


To extend your protection beyond your immediate area, consider trademarking your business name. This provides exclusive rights to your name on a national or even international level, ensuring that no one else can use it for similar businesses.

Monitor and Enforce Your Rights


It's essential to keep an eye on the market and be vigilant about any potential infringements on your business name. If you discover any unauthorized usage, take legal action promptly to protect your brand's integrity.

Build a Strong Online Presence


In the digital age, your online presence is vital. Secure your business name as a domain and create profiles on major social media platforms. This not only solidifies your online brand identity but also prevents others from using your name online.

Protect Your Domain Name


Registering your domain name is crucial in today's internet-driven world. It ensures that your website is easily accessible to your customers and prevents others from capitalizing on your name for their gain.

Use Contracts and Agreements


When collaborating with partners, suppliers, or employees, use contracts and agreements that explicitly state the protection of your business name. This adds an extra layer of security and prevents any unauthorized use.

Be Mindful of Social Media


Social media is a powerful tool for brand promotion, but it can also be a breeding ground for brand misuse. Regularly monitor your social media handles and report any impersonation or misuse to the platform administrators.

Maintain a Good Reputation


Your reputation is closely tied to your business name. Uphold high standards of quality, ethics, and customer service to build a positive reputation that bolsters your name's value.

Seek Legal Counsel


If you encounter legal issues related to your business name, it's essential to consult with an attorney experienced in intellectual property and trademark law. They can guide you through the complexities of legal protection.

Regularly Review Your Strategy


The business landscape evolves, and so should your protection strategy. Regularly review and update your tactics to stay ahead of potential threats to your business name.
